Carrot Cake Bars with Cream Cheese Frosting

Ingredients

  • 1 1/2 cups all-purpose flour
  • 1 tsp baking powder
  • 1/2 tsp baking soda
  • 1/2 tsp salt
  • 1 tsp ground cinnamon
  • 1/2 tsp ground nutmeg
  • 1/4 tsp ground ginger
  • 1/2 cup unsalted butter, softened
  • 1/2 cup brown sugar
  • 1/4 cup granulated sugar
  • 2 large eggs
  • 1 tsp vanilla extract
  • 1 1/2 cups grated carrots
  • 1/2 cup crushed pineapple, drained
  • 1/2 cup chopped walnuts (optional)
  • 1/2 cup cream cheese, softened (for frosting)
  • 1/4 cup unsalted butter, softened (for frosting)
  • 1 cup powdered sugar (for frosting)
  • 1 tsp vanilla extract (for frosting)

Instructions

  1. Preheat your oven to 350°F (175°C) and line a 9×9-inch baking pan with parchment paper, lightly greasing it.
  2. In a medium bowl, whisk together the flour, baking powder, baking soda, salt, cinnamon, nutmeg, and ginger.
  3. In a large bowl, beat the butter, brown sugar, and granulated sugar until light and fluffy. Add eggs one at a time, mixing well after each addition. Stir in vanilla extract.
  4. Gradually combine the dry ingredients with the wet mixture until just incorporated.
  5. Fold in the grated carrots, pineapple, and walnuts if using.
  6. Pour the batter into the prepared pan and smooth the top with a spatula.
  7. Bake for 30-35 minutes, or until a toothpick inserted in the center comes out clean. Allow bars to cool completely in the pan.
  8. For the frosting, beat the cream cheese and butter together until smooth. Gradually add powdered sugar and vanilla extract until creamy.
  9. Spread the frosting evenly over the cooled carrot cake bars. Slice into squares for serving.

Tips & Notes

  • Finely grate the carrots for a smoother texture in the bars.
  • Cool the bars completely before frosting to prevent melting.
  • Add raisins or shredded coconut for additional flavor and texture.
  • Store in an airtight container in the refrigerator for up to 5 days.
